Hibernation time is around 14 seconds. Resume time is lil longer around 25 seconds. i dont know why but POST does take some time. after POST Resuming is 6-8 Seconds.
Normal startup time is again 30 seconds + . I have checked the BIOS settings. but no settings for it. Again After Post Booting is 10-15 Seconds. Maybe Intel might provide BIOS update. Lots of People are facing issue with GCLF board.

@gigy. Resume windows faster. Also all Opened App. will be handy to access.
I noticed that whenever i hibernate my PC from CF. and resume. I get the CF Screen. but i cant play any songs due to Sound card not Recognized. So i have to load CF again.
So its a bug in CF itself. coz i can play the Audio from WMP.
